MySQL是一款常用的關系型數據庫管理系統,它可以用來存儲各種類型的數據,包括富文本格式的文章。如果要在MySQL中存儲富文本格式的文章,可以采用以下步驟:
第一步,創建一張存儲文章的表,可以使用如下的SQL語句:
CREATE TABLE article (
id INT(11) NOT NULL AUTO_INCREMENT,
title VARCHAR(255) NOT NULL,
content TEXT NOT NULL,
PRIMARY KEY (id)
);
這個表包含三個字段:id、title和content。其中id是文章的唯一標識符,title是文章的標題,content是文章的內容,使用TEXT類型來存儲富文本格式的內容。
第二步,將文章的內容存儲在數據庫中。在PHP中,可以使用以下的代碼來將文章的內容存儲在數據庫中:
$content = "
這是一篇富文本格式的文章。
下面是一段代碼:
function hello() {
echo 'Hello, world!';
}
";
$sql = "INSERT INTO article (title, content) VALUES ('文章標題', '$content')";
$result = mysqli_query($conn, $sql);
這個代碼將一篇富文本格式的文章的內容保存在了$content變量中,并使用INSERT INTO語句將文章的標題和內容插入到article表中。
第三步,從數據庫中獲取文章的內容。在PHP中,可以使用以下的代碼來從數據庫中獲取文章的內容:
$id = 1;
$sql = "SELECT * FROM article WHERE id = $id";
$result = mysqli_query($conn, $sql);
$row = mysqli_fetch_assoc($result);
$content = $row['content'];
這個代碼使用SELECT語句從article表中獲取id為1的文章的內容,并將內容保存在$content變量中。
最后,可以將獲取到的富文本格式的內容在頁面上顯示出來。可以使用如下的代碼:
echo $content;
這個代碼將獲取到的富文本格式的內容輸出到頁面上,其中的標簽和
標簽會自動解析為HTML的p標簽和pre標簽,從而展示出文章的正文和代碼部分。